Transaction 31544bf16e154f891b905073ea522de1a24e977392a614e6d7531183ab08b638
1 Input
1 Output
-
31544bf16e154f891b905073ea522de1a24e977392a614e6d7531183ab08b638:0
- value
- 428200
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 48a7d597538645bda9eb31297de236221d1cf01a64f9fddbe8f63a84eeb19074
- address
- bc1pfznat96nsezmm20txy5hmc3kygw3euq6vnulmklg7cagfm43jp6qgx5p2p